Rivian and Ben & Jerry's: A Sweet Electric Collaboration

Rivian and Ben & Jerry's: A Sweet Electric Collaboration

Rivian and Ben & Jerry's: A Sweet Electric Collaboration

In an exciting leap towards sustainability, Rivian is teaming up with Ben & Jerry's to unveil innovative electric scoop trucks. This partnership represents a fresh approach to how ice cream fans can enjoy their favorite treats while benefiting the planet.

Debuting at South by Southwest

Fans will get their first glimpse of these electrified scoop trucks at the iconic South by Southwest festival. This event serves as a great platform for introducing the future of ice cream distribution to an audience that values creativity and ecological responsibility.

What Makes the Scoop Trucks Unique

Equipped on the Rivian Commercial Van, these scoop trucks revamp the traditional ice cream truck experience. They promise not only the joy of delicious ice cream but also the reliability and performance that come with electric vehicles, thereby reducing the environmental impact associated with traditional fuel sources.

The Joy of Ice Cream on Wheels

Post-SXSW, these trucks will embark on a nationwide journey, spreading joy and tasty treats in various communities. Excitement is building among fans who are eager to catch a glimpse of these electric marvels and savor some of Ben & Jerry's renowned ice cream.

By merging their operational practices with sustainability, Ben & Jerry's aims to positively impact the environment and its community. This collaboration with Rivian marks a significant step towards reducing fossil fuel dependency while ensuring high-quality ice cream experiences.

The People Behind the Project

Brian Gase, Senior Director of Prototype Development at Rivian, expressed enthusiasm about the collaboration. He highlighted the fun and excitement that the new scoop trucks are expected to bring to fans. Alongside him, Sean Slattery, US Integrated Marketing project lead for Ben & Jerry's, echoed the sentiment, noting how working with Rivian aligns with their commitment to sustainability.

Rivian's Commitment to Sustainability

The Rivian Commercial Van boasts an impressive range, allowing for extended reach at events, catering opportunities, and serving ice cream to countless fans. This advancement signifies Rivian's commitment to electrifying fleets and contributing to the movement towards sustainable transportation solutions.
